Hill−start assist control
system
The hill−start assist control system as-
sists in starting to drive a steep or a
slippery hill. When you start to move
up a hill slope, the system helps to
prevent the vehicle from rolling back-
ward in the interval while moving the
foot from the brake pedal to the accel-
erator pedal.
CAUTION
Do not rely excessively on the hill−
D
start assist control system. The ve-
hicle may not
be able
to start
smoothly on road surfaces or off−
road surfaces such as extremely
steep slopes or icy roads, on which
sliding can occur very easily.
Do not use the hill−start assist con-
D
trol system to park the vehicle. This
system is not designed as a func-
tion for parking the vehicle on a
uphill slope.

TO ACTIVATE THE HILL−START ASSIST
CONTROL SYSTEM
The hill−start assist control system will
operate for maximum of 2 seconds. The
brake pedal must be depressed further
to activate the system when all of the
following
conditions
apply
with
brake pedal is depressed:
At this time, one beep will be heard.
When the selector lever is not in "P"
D
When the accelerator pedal is not de-
D
pressed
When the parking brake is not applied
D
When the vehicle is stopped
D
The system is designed to operate when
the vehicle is starting on uphill slope;
therefore, if the transmission selector le-
ver is in "P", it will not operate.
the
When the hill−start assist control system
is operating, the slip indicator light flashes
and the stoplights and high mounted stop-
light are lit.
When any of the following is performed,
the system will stop operation. At this
time, two beeps will be heard and the slip
indicator light will go off.
Shifting the selector lever to "P"
D
Applying the parking brake
D
Depressing the brake pedal
D
If the accelerator pedal is depressed, the
system will also stop operation without
beep sounds.
